This specialization is for educators seeking to improve and expand their repertoire of online teaching skills related to the design, development and delivery of effective and engaging online courses and lessons for school age and adult learners. Learning in the 21st century no longer takes place exclusively between the four walls of a physical classroom. With advances in technology, learners now expect to be offered flexible study modes outside of the traditional face-to-face model. This specialization explores the foundational skills required to design, develop and deliver an effective and engaging online course or lesson – a vital capability for any modern-day educator. This specialization is for anyone who is responsible for designing and/or delivering online learning experiences, as well as educators and teachers who are familiar with face-to-face learning and teaching and are now adapting to online environments. I have engaged with several key concepts that are essential for fostering effective online education. Understanding these principles not only enhances my instructional practices but also improves the learning experiences of my students. Firstly, the differentiation between various course models—online, hybrid, and hyflex—has been crucial. Each model presents unique opportunities and challenges that affect student interaction and overall learning outcomes. Online courses provide flexibility, while hybrid models blend face-to-face and virtual elements, catering to diverse learning preferences. Hyflex models, which allow students to choose between attending in-person or online, further empower learners by accommodating their individual needs. The theory of transactional distance is another vital area of focus. This concept explains the psychological space created by distance education, highlighting the impact on communication and learner autonomy. High levels of transactional distance can lead to feelings of isolation among students. To mitigate this, I have implemented strategies such as increasing dialogue through regular check-ins and enhancing course structure to promote a sense of community. Cognitive load is also a significant consideration in my teaching practice. Understanding the three types of cognitive load—intrinsic, extraneous, and germane—has informed my approach to information delivery. By simplifying content and providing clear instructions, I can help students manage their cognitive load, allowing them to focus on meaningful learning without becoming overwhelmed.
